I was looking at energy suspension's bushing for the stock monte ss bars 1 1/4" and they list a regular urethane bushing and a bushing that is greasable. Which is better? I think the greasable one would work for the simple reason that if it starts to squeak you can lube it. does that make sense? pricewise they are about the same. thanks Steve

Greaseable is the way to go. It cuts down on wear. I've been turning my none greaseables to greaseables for years.
